Output 771785b8c14dd73aef6ea2ecb5dc64ff11a9267a06cf0cfd53d2cb1ed10ffb7e:1

value
50290491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03cbf5d66e671b6804452d1255444a772d65c62a OP_EQUAL
address
3236HXffwVWQEZBLGJN7REEa9HLypTaKca
transaction
771785b8c14dd73aef6ea2ecb5dc64ff11a9267a06cf0cfd53d2cb1ed10ffb7e
spent
true